Workers Files 1936-1942

Scope and Content

Contains drafts, copies, notations, and documentation of work produced from Federal Writers’ Project personnel, with the bulk including Guido L. Geilfuss, Tom Thienes, Henry McCullough, True Tillson, Grace Meinen, and Harry B. Mills. Dates range from 1936 to 1942.

Oversized Posters 1931-1942

Scope and Content

Comprised of 1 flat box, 1 oversized flat box, and 1 oversized folder. Posters focus primarily on World War II and civilian defense. Box 200 also includes maps of Los Angeles. Dates range primarily from 1931 to 1942.
